The
immunomodulatory function of endothelial cells (EC) includes the
initiation of leukocyte margination, diapedesis, and activation through
the upregulation of various cell surface-associated molecules. However,
the effect that EC have on the phagocytic function of neighboring
monocytes and macrophages is less well described. To address this
issue, microvascular EC were cocultured with murine peritoneal
macrophages, first in direct contact, then in a noncontact coculture
system, and macrophage phagocytosis and phagocytic killing were
assessed. The presence of increasing concentrations of EC resulted in a
dose-dependent increase in macrophage phagocytic killing. This
stimulatory effect was inhibited in a dose-dependent manner by the
pretreatment of macrophage/EC cocultures with WEB-2086 or CV-6209,
specific platelet-activating factor (PAF)-receptor antagonists, but not
by anti-tumor necrosis factor-
, anti-interleukin (IL)-1
, or
anti-IL-1
. Furthermore, the effect was reproduced in the absence of
EC by the exogenous administration of nanomolar concentrations of PAF.
Microvascular EC potentiate macrophage phagocytic killing via the
release of a soluble signal; PAF appears to be an important component
of that signal.
